Main indicators of temperature and operating modes
The most commonly used elements on the control panel are digital indicators that display the current temperature in the refrigerator and freezer compartments. These values may be in Celsius or Fahrenheit, depending on your regional settings. To switch between scales, a long press of a key combination is often required, which will be indicated by a flashing icon.
Next to the numbers there are usually icons indicating active energy saving or accelerated cooling functions. For example, a burning snowflake symbol indicates the operation of the compressor, and its blinking may indicate a transient process after defrosting or turning on the power.
- ❄️ Cooling On mode - standard operating mode in which the compressor maintains the set temperature.
- 🌡️ Temperature indicator - shows the current degrees, blinking indicates a set of cold temperatures after loading warm products.
- 🌿 Eco Mode —energy saving mode, in which the temperature in the refrigerator compartment rises to a safe maximum (usually +7...+9°C).
- 🚀 Power Cool / Power Freeze —accelerated cooling or freezing functions that work for a limited time.
⚠️ Attention: Long-term activation of accelerated freezing modes (Power Freeze) for more than 48 hours can lead to increased energy consumption and excessive freezing of the evaporator if the automatic defrosting function is not used.
If the icon is lit on the display Lock (often in the form of a lock), this means that the control panel is locked from accidental presses, which is especially important in homes with small children. Unlocking is usually done by simultaneously pressing two buttons, for example, "Freezer" and "Fridge", for 3-5 seconds.
Fault and open door warning system
One of the most important functions of a modern refrigerator is monitoring the tightness of the chambers. If you forget to close the door tightly, the system will notify you with an audible signal and a visual indicator. As a rule, the open door icon lights up on the display or the corresponding segment blinks.
Sound accompaniment can be intrusive, so many models allow you to turn off the sound by simply pressing any button on the panel, although the visual signal will remain until the cause is eliminated. Ignoring this warning leads to moisture condensation, ice formation and increased load on the compressor.
In some models with the system Smart Diagnosis if the door is not closed for a long time, a letter code or a specific combination of flashes may appear on the screen. This helps the technician, during remote diagnostics, understand that the problem lies in the seal or misalignment of the door, and not in the electronics.
- 🚪 Door Alarm —a flashing door outline or a special symbol indicating a leak.
- 🔊 Audible signal —an intermittent squeak that accompanies a visual warning.
- ⏱️ Waiting timer —the system gives about 1-2 minutes for the door to close before the alarm turns on.
It is important to check the status sealing rubberif the open door indicator lights up, although visually the door seems closed. Foreign objects, stuck food or deformation of the seal may give a false signal to the security system.
Indication of defrost mode and ice maker
Refrigerators Samsung with system No Frost automatically carry out evaporator defrosting cycles. During this process, the compressor may switch off and sometimes specific symbols appear on the display that are not errors. The user does not need to intervene in this process.
If your model has an ice maker installed, the panel will display indicators for the water level, the ice production process, or the need to clean the system. The "Ice Max" symbol or similar designation will indicate that the ice container is full and production has stopped.
| Symbol / Indicator | Meaning | User action |
|---|---|---|
| 💧 Water Filter | Replace the water filter (flashing or lit red) | Replace the cartridge and reset the timer with the "Ice/Water" button |
| 🧊 Ice Maker | Ice maker on | Normal operation |
| 🚫 Ice Off | Ice production disabled | Enable if needed ice |
| 🌀 Defrost | The defrosting process is in progress | Do not turn off the power supply, wait for the end |
⚠️ Attention: If the water filter replacement indicator is constantly on after installing a new cartridge, you must forcefully reset the resource counter by holding the corresponding button for 3 seconds.
For models with a water dispenser, it is critical to monitor the filter indicator. Ignoring the signal to replace the cartridge can lead to a decrease in water pressure and deterioration in the quality of cleaning, as well as damage to the liquid supply pump.
Deciphering error codes (Error Codes)
When the electronics detects a serious malfunction, the digital display stops showing the temperature and begins to broadcast an error code. These codes consist of the letter "C" (Cooling, freezer) or "F" (Freezer/Fridge, refrigerator) and numbers indicating a specific unit.
The most common codes, such as 22C, 25F or 88Cindicate problems with temperature sensors, a faulty fan or an open circuit defrost heater. The appearance of the code is often accompanied by a sound signal and blocking of some functions.
Code 88C or 88 often indicates a malfunction of the main control board or power problems. In this case, a simple reboot can rarely be done, and it is necessary to check the voltage in the network and the condition of the wires.
- ❄️ C series codes (Cooling) - refer to problems in the freezer compartment (sensors, heaters).
- 🌡️ F series codes (Fridge/Freezer) - may indicate errors in the refrigerator compartment or general errors fans.
- 🔌 E series codes —communication errors between boards or display.
There is also combined codewhen all segments on the display are blinking or chaotic symbols appear. This may indicate a power surge that damaged the electronic board or simply caused a failure in the controller software.
Diagnostic modes and hidden functions
For service engineers and advanced users in refrigerators Samsung a hidden diagnostic mode is provided. It is entered by a combination of buttons (often pressing “Power Freeze” and “Fridge” simultaneously for 8-12 seconds), after which a sound signal is heard and all segments light up on the display.
In this mode you can check the operation of fans, compressor, valves and sensors. Switching between tests is done by pressing the "Freezer" button, and starting or stopping the test is done by pressing the "Fridge" button. This allows you to localize the malfunction without disassembling the unit.

Resetting settings and returning to factory settings
In cases where the refrigerator behaves incorrectly, the display is “buggy” or the indicators light up chaotically, a complete system reset may be required. This does not always mean repair; sometimes it is enough to reboot the “brains” of the device, similar to a computer.
The safest way is to disconnect the device from the power supply for 10-15 minutes. This allows the capacitors on the control board to be completely discharged and the memory to be cleared of temporary errors. After turning on, the system will conduct self-diagnosis and can return to normal mode.
There is also a soft reset via key combinations, depending on the specific model. For example, holding down the "Power Cool" and "Power Freeze" buttons for 10 seconds can initiate a reboot of the controller without unplugging from the outlet.
- 🔌 Hard Reset — completely turn off the power for 15 minutes to reset all temporary errors.
- 🔄 Soft Reset —reboot through the menu or a combination of buttons without losing data about the resource filters.
- ⚙️ Factory Reset —return all parameters to factory settings (temperature, alarms, Wi-Fi settings).
It is important to understand that resetting the settings does not eliminate physical damage. If the temperature sensor is burned out, then after a reboot, the error code 22C or another corresponding code will appear again after several cycles of compressor operation.
Frequently asked questions (FAQ)
Why does the temperature indicator flash and a squeak sound?
Temperature flashing usually means that the achieved temperature regime in the chamber has been violated. This happens when you turn it on for the first time, after defrosting, or if you put in a lot of warm food. The squeak is a “Door Alarm” signal, warning that the door has been open for more than 2 minutes. Close the door and wait a few hours.
What does error code 25F on the display mean?
The code 25F (or variations with the number 25) most often indicates a malfunction of the defrost sensor in the freezer. This could be a wire break, contact oxidation, or failure of the sensor itself. The continuity of the circuit is required and, possibly, replacement of the sensor.
How to unlock the control panel if the lock is on?
To unlock, find a button with a picture of a lock or a combination of buttons (usually “Power Freeze” + “Power Cool” or “Fridge” + “Freezer”). Press and hold them simultaneously for 3-5 seconds until the lock icon disappears and a beep sounds.
Why does the refrigerator show all segments after a power surge?
This is a sign of a malfunction of the main control board. The surge could damage the batteries or cause a software glitch. Try doing a hard reset (unplug for 15 minutes). If the situation repeats, you may need to replace the PCB board.
